Output 85e36fbee9ff4b54a5fb9409a2cfc0b3d8acae912fba7ddedd15e856462d8d12:1

value
3160950
script pubkey
OP_0 OP_PUSHBYTES_20 143e7c560de560c70cbbb2ac76c38930f985611e
address
bc1qzsl8c4sdu4svwr9mk2k8dsufxruc2cg7efdf2f
transaction
85e36fbee9ff4b54a5fb9409a2cfc0b3d8acae912fba7ddedd15e856462d8d12
confirmations
170785
spent
true